    BOUGEOIR A MAIN A ECRAN D'EPOQUE RESTAURATION
    TRAVAIL PROBABLEMENT RUSSE
    En bronze ciselé et doré, muni d'un écran ajustable en hauteur et sommé de grifons, reposant sur une base en forme de rognon en acajou peut-être rapporté, muni de deux bobèches, une mouchette et une prise
    Hauteur: 34,5 cm. (13¾ in.), Largeur: 20 cm. (8¼ in.) (2)
